Where is Rumford?
Where is Rumford located?
Rumford, Rumford, United States of America (approx. 44.554268°, -70.55145°)
Where is Rumford on the map?
Rumford - Bangor
Rumford - Boston
Rumford - Boston Airport
Rumford - Manchester Airport
Rumford - Bar Harbor
Rumford - Fitchburg
Rumford - Portland Airport
Rumford - New Hampshire
Rumford - Portland
Rumford - Providence
Rumford - Providence Airport
Rumford - Quebec
Rumford - Boston
Rumford - Lincoln
Rumford - Salem
{"latitude":44.554268,"longitude":-70.55145,"title":"Rumford"}